Eligibility Criteria

Inclusion Criteria

  • Patients aged 60y or more who are scheduled for elective total hip joint replacement (THJR) or total knee joint replacement (TKJR) who do not have neurological deficit; give informed consent; have no contraindication to neuropsychological testing; and reside in accessible proximity to the hospital to enable investigators to administer neuropsychological testing at patients' home.

Exclusion Criteria

  • Pre\-existing neurological or clinically evident neurovascular disease (eg. stroke); Clnical Dementia Rating score \>\=1 (exclude frank dementia); anticipated difficulty with neuropsychological assessment, such as English not being the prime language, blindness, deafness; associated medical problems that may lead to significant loss to follow\-up (ASA physical status IV or higher); geographical remoteness.
